Product Description
The SL045022-D-PP-2WR by INA is a precision-engineered double row full complement cylindrical roller bearing designed for heavy-duty applications. This high-performance bearing is meticulously crafted to deliver exceptional load-carrying capacity and durability. With a double row design and full complement of rollers, it provides superior radial support and enhanced rigidity, making it ideal for demanding industrial environments.
INA’s innovative engineering ensures that the SL045022-D-PP-2WR bearing operates smoothly and efficiently, reducing friction and wear for extended service life. The PP (lip seals on both sides) feature provides added protection against contaminants, moisture, and debris, enhancing reliability and performance in harsh conditions. Additional information
| Brand | INA |
|---|---|
| Bore | C – Cylindrical Bore |
| Seal | 2L – LS-seal at Both Sides |
| Cage Type | FC – Full Complement, No Cage |
| Precision | Standard Precision |
| Heat Stabilization | No Heat Stabilization – Temperatures up to 120 °C |
| Radial Internal Play | Cn Normal Internal Play |
